Match score not available

Staff Software Engineer, Mobile (React Native)

78% Flex
EXTRA HOLIDAYS - EXTRA PARENTAL LEAVE
Remote: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

6+ years experience in React Native, Expertise in JavaScript and React Native frameworks, Experience with mobile app design principles, Portfolio of released applications.

Key responsabilities:

  • Design and develop mobile apps using React Native
  • Collaborate with global teams for app goals
  • Enhance app capabilities with cloud services
  • Create automated testing processes
CharterUP logo
CharterUP Information Technology & Services Scaleup https://www.charterup.com/
51 - 200 Employees
See more CharterUP offers

Job description

Logo Jobgether

Your missions

About CharterUP

If you’ve been searching for a career with a company that values creativity, innovation, and teamwork, consider this your ticket to ride.

CharterUP is on a mission to shake up the fragmented $30 billion group ground transportation industry - with over 10,000 independent charter bus, minibus, and van operators across America. CharterUP is the first online marketplace that connects customers to a network of bus operators from coast to coast, currently holding over 600 operators on the network. Our revolutionary platform makes it possible to book a bus in just 60 seconds – eliminating the stress and hassle of coordinating group transportation for anyone from wedding parties to Fortune 500 companies. We’re introducing transparency, accountability, and accessibility to an industry as archaic as phone books. By delivering real-time availability and pricing, customers can use the CharterUP marketplace to easily compare quotes, vehicles, safety records, and reviews.

We're seeking team members who are revved up and ready to use technology to make a positive impact. As part of the CharterUP team, you'll work alongside some of the brightest minds in the technology and transportation industries. You'll help drive the future of group travel and help raise the bar for service standards in the industry, so customers can always ride with confidence.

But we're not just about getting from point A to point B – CharterUP is also committed to sustainability. By promoting group travel, we can significantly reduce carbon emissions and help steer our planet toward a greener future. In 2022 alone, we eliminated over 1 billion miles worth of carbon emissions with 25 million miles driven.

We’re a remote-first workplace, but we encourage collaboration and connection with hubs in Atlanta, GA and Austin, TX. CharterUP is looking for passionate and driven individuals to join our team and help steer us toward a better future for group transportation. On the heels of a $60 million Series A funding round, we’re ready to kick our growth into overdrive – and we want you to be part of the ride.

About The Role

Title: Lead React Native Software Engineer

Reports to: Director of Engineering

Location: Brazil (Remote)

CharterUP is seeking a Lead Native Software Engineer to join our team in developing a cutting-edge application for our charter bus marketplace. This application will streamline trip management, ticketing, tracking, and customer engagement; providing a seamless experience for users across multiple platforms. The ideal candidate will have a strong background in React Native development, with a keen eye for design and a commitment to creating efficient, scalable solutions.

What You'll Do

  • Design and develop mobile applications for both iOS and Android platforms using React Native
  • Work closely with a global team of React Native developers, backend engineers, UI/UX designers, and product managers to ensure the application meets business goals and user needs
  • Work with native modules, cloud services and third-party APIs when required to enhance the app’s capabilities and user experience
  • Develop tooling and processes to support our mobile application development and life-cycle
  • Create automated testing processes to ensure quality and performance

What You'll Bring

  • 6+ years of experience as a professional React Native engineer with a portfolio of released applications in the App Store and Google Play Store
  • Strong proficiency in JavaScript, including ES6+ syntax
  • Experience with React Native frameworks and libraries, especially Redux for state management
  • Extensive experience with cloud messaging APIs, location APIs, and push notifications
  • Understanding of RESTful APIs and web socket integration
  • Strong understanding of mobile app design guidelines and UI/UX principles
  • Excellent communication and teamwork abilities
  • Comfortable taking ownership end-to-end of deliverables
  • Portfolio: React Native portfolio showcasing your best work, including links to applications you have developed or contributed to in the App Store and Google Play Store.

Nice To Have

  • Experience with payment gateway integration and mobile payment technologies
  • Knowledge of other cross-platform mobile development frameworks or native development (Swift for iOS, Kotlin/Java for Android)
  • Industry Experience: background in transit, on-demand, or logistics, understanding the complexities of these sectors.
  • App Integrations: experience with payment gateway integration, mobile payment technologies, location services, and backend infrastructure development for enhanced app functionality.

Recruiting Process

  • Step 1 - Introductory interview with Talent Acquisition member
  • Step 2 - Hiring Manager behavioral interview
  • Step 3 - Team interviews
  • Step 4 - Offer!
  • Welcome aboard!

CharterUP is an Equal Opportunity/Affirmative Action Employ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. We make all employment decisions including hiring, evaluation, termination, promotional and training opportunities, without regard to race, religion, color, sex, age, national origin, ancestry, sexual orientation, physical handicap, mental disability, medical condition, disability, gender or identity or expression, pregnancy or pregnancy-related condition, marital status, height or weight.

Required profile

Experience

Level of experience: Senior (5-10 years)
Industry :
Information Technology & Services
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Go Premium: Access the World's Largest Selection of Remote Jobs!

  • Largest Inventory: Dive into the world's largest remote job inventory. More than half of these opportunities can't be found on standard platforms.
  • Personalized Matches: Our AI-driven algorithms ensure you find job listings perfectly matched to your skills and preferences.
  • Application fast-lane: Discover positions where you rank in the TOP 5% of applicants, and get personally introduced to recruiters with Jobgether.
  • Try out our Premium Benefits with a 7-Day FREE TRIAL.
    No obligations. Cancel anytime.
Upgrade to Premium

Find more Software Engineer jobs